A 17-year-old, along with his mother and uncle, has been arrested for their involvement in the armed robbery of a U.S. postal worker in Augusta, Georgia. During the incident on November 13, the postal carrier was confronted by suspects who physically restrained him while brandishing a firearm, leading to the theft of two items from him.
The arrested teen, Darrion Antwon Williams, faces serious charges including armed robbery and weapon possession, while his mother, Chavonne Thomas, and uncle, Carl Gant, are implicated for providing false statements and concealing a fugitive. Authorities emphasize the need for community awareness and intervention to prevent youth from making dangerous choices, reminding families that enabling such behavior can lead to further legal consequences.
